African Family Service foundation is 501 (C)3 registered in New York state. The mission is to provide services to the African refuges’ community residing in Rochester, New York. The organization plays great role in refuges settlement program, such as securing accommodation and providing health and social services. Additionally, the organization created an after-school program for refuges children. Internationally, it runs programs like vocational school, heath center and public library. These projects are based in Aweil state, Republic of South Sudan. RSS.

Mission

To offer assistance and educational support to the refuges’ “African families” where they maybe situated and in making a transition to the cultural changes they encountered after they move to the United States of America.

Vision

To educate the general public through outreach and other efforts as to the positive cultural aspect of the African Family.

Our mission is to build a Vocational Institute in order to provide the victimized children of the war-torn South Sudan with effective apprenticeships, technical skills, or trades in the disciplines of carpentry, metal work, automobile mechanics and farming.
